Transaction 89569104bf4d7542627674d602a5d63b74df86643188907762f34faa6daed46b
1 Input
1 Output
-
89569104bf4d7542627674d602a5d63b74df86643188907762f34faa6daed46b:0
- value
- 64144
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 25b91ebbdd2c42cf7481522bb932a98f75bf0198 OP_EQUALVERIFY OP_CHECKSIG
- address
- 14STmTwqCP2SLVxSFpNcLH7wWzmfLQ19JJ